2019 global semiconductor equipment sales slip 7%

Semiconductor equipment manufacturers worldwide logged sales of USD 59.8 billion in 2019, a 7% drop from the all-time high of USD 64.5 billion in 2018, according to SEMI.

Taiwan claimed the largest market for new semiconductor equipment last year with sales of USD 17.12 billion after a 68% growth surge, dislodging Korea from the top spot. China maintained its position as the second largest equipment market with sales of USD 13.45 billion, followed by Korea, at USD 9.97 billion, after receipts fell 44%. While the new equipment markets in Japan, Europe, and Rest of World contracted, North America equipment sales jumped 40% to USD 8.15 billion in 2019, the region's third consecutive annual increase. Global sales of wafer processing equipment fell 6% in 2019, while other front-end segment sales grew 9 %. Assembly and packaging along with test equipment sales also faltered, declining 27% and 11%, respectively, while sales to China rose across all major equipment segments except for assembly and packaging. Annual Billings by Region in Billions of U.S. Dollars with Year-Over-Year Rates
Region20192018% Change
Taiwan17.1210.1768%
China13.4513.113%
Korea9.9717.71-44%
North America8.155.8340%
Japan6.279.47-34%
Rest of the World2.524.04-38%
Europe2.274.22-46%
Total59.7564.53-7%
